Taro Logo

Software Engineer II, Android, Software Development Transformation

A global technology company that develops innovative products and services used by billions of users worldwide.
Android
Mid-Level Software Engineer
In-Person
5,000+ Employees
1+ year of experience
Enterprise SaaS · Consumer

Description For Software Engineer II, Android, Software Development Transformation

Google is seeking a Software Engineer II to join their Android Software Development Transformation team. This role is crucial in developing and optimizing tools and pipelines that enhance the Android software development lifecycle. As part of the Google Pixel team, you'll contribute to shaping the future of Pixel devices and services through advanced designs and techniques. The position involves working with large-scale systems, creating data visualization tools, and implementing process improvements that directly impact Android engineering efficiency. You'll collaborate with engineering and program management teams to deliver data-driven solutions and insights. This role offers the opportunity to work on critical projects at Google while having the flexibility to grow and evolve with the business. The position combines technical expertise in Android development with data analysis and tool creation, making it an ideal opportunity for engineers interested in both mobile development and developer productivity.

Last updated 2 days ago

Responsibilities For Software Engineer II, Android, Software Development Transformation

  • Develop pipelines and tools for analyzing and visualizing data generated across the android software development lifecycle
  • Develop internal applications and user interfaces to streamline workflows and enhance efficiency for android engineers and program managers
  • Analyze lifecycle processes using techniques such as process mining to identify and report bottlenecks and improvement areas
  • Generate reports and data-driven insights to assist teams in understanding trends, optimizing workflows, and improving issue triage efficiency
  • Collaborate with engineering and program management teams to understand their requirements and deliver tailored data solutions

Requirements For Software Engineer II, Android, Software Development Transformation

Java
Python
JavaScript
  • Bachelor's degree or equivalent practical experience
  • 1 year of experience with software development in one or more programming languages (e.g., Python, C, C++, Java, JavaScript)
  • Experience in developing tools/systems for internal developers
  • Experience in android system development
  • Experience in data pipelines, business process improvement and automation
  • Experience in pipeline and user flow optimization

Benefits For Software Engineer II, Android, Software Development Transformation

Medical Insurance
Dental Insurance
Vision Insurance
401k
Parental Leave
  • Comprehensive health benefits
  • Retirement plans
  • Parental leave
  • Equal opportunity employer

Interested in this job?

Jobs Related To Google Software Engineer II, Android, Software Development Transformation